(2) The activities of the members of the Board of Trustees are honorary. The Minister for<br />

Agriculture, Nature Protection and the Environment is empowered to issue statutory orders to<br />

regulate further details, especially regarding the appointment, method of working and<br />

remuneration of the Board of Trustees.<br />

(3) The head of the National Park Administration or his deputy shall attend the meetings.<br />

§21<br />

Restriction of Basic Rights<br />

On the basis of this Law, the basic rights to physical integrity and personal freedom, to<br />

freedom of assembly and to the inviolability of the home may be restricted (Article 2 Para. 2,<br />

Article 8 and Article 13 of the Basic Law; Article 3 Para. 1, Article 8 and Article 10 of the<br />

Constitution of the Free State of Thuringia).<br />

§22<br />

Misdemeanours<br />

(1) A person is considered to be committing a misdemeanour as defined in § 54 Para. 1 No.<br />

1 ThurNatPA if they violate, deliberately or by negligence, one of the prohibitions in § 8. In<br />

addition, a person is considered to have committed a misdemeanour who deliberately or<br />

negligently<br />

1. collects in violation of the provisions of § 12 or<br />

2. carries out grazing activities contrary to § 13 Para. 1 and without the required approval or<br />

without a usage or lease agreement or outside the framework of an existing effective usage<br />

or lease agreement.<br />

(2) Misdemeanours according to Paragraph 1 Sentence 1 are punishable with a fine of up to<br />

fifty thousand euros, misdemeanours according to Paragraph 1 Sentence 2 No. 1 may be<br />

punished with a fine of up to five thousand euros and misdemeanours according to<br />

Paragraph 1 Sentence 2 No. 2 can be punished with a fine up to twenty-five thousand euros.<br />

(3) § 54 ThurNatPA is not affected.<br />
